The National Institutes of Health (NIH) states that for healthy adults aged 19 and older, the Tolerable Upper Intake Level (UL) for vitamin D is 4,000 IU (100 mcg) per day. This article explores what is the maximum daily limit of vitamin D3 and why exceeding it can be dangerous.

While it is extremely rare to get an overdose of naturally occurring folate from food, consuming excessive synthetic folic acid supplements, especially above 1mg daily, poses significant health risks.
